# You steer; the case agent executes
Relex's internal agent already runs a two-mind pattern: a reasoning model emits
a structured directive, a lighter model executes it. Over MCP **you are the
reasoning layer one level up** — you steer the entire case agent, and it
executes with the platform's grounding, redaction, and case state.
**The delegation rule (canonical — other skills point here):** never draft,
research, or re-derive case content yourself when the case agent can produce
it. Your outputs are *directives*, *adversarial reviews*, and the *concluded
distillation*. Its outputs are the drafts, the grounded research, the case
state. You bring judgment; it brings labor and platform truth.
## The session (branch-backed, behind the scenes)
Your first `POST /agent {type:"case_req", caseId, payload:{prompt}}` on an
active case auto-opens a **steering branch** — a private side-thread of the
case timeline. Every steering turn lands there, not on the main conversation.
The humans on the case see a collapsed "Claude steering session" marker with
your user's role and "via Claude" attribution; they can expand it read-only.
Work openly — it is all auditable — but nothing you do exists on the main
thread until you conclude.
